There's a passage in the BOTNS where Severian gives a justification for the Torturers Guild. He talks about long term imprisonment being a drain on society, work programs taking jobs from the indigent, etc. Unlike Severian, I forget things and I can't recall which book it's in. A memory jog or pointer to the quote would be greatly appreciated.

It's in "Sword of the Lictor," when Dorcas is lying ill in the inn at Thrax. I don't recall if it's when he first brings her there or on his next visit. --Dan'l
